Can any auto body shop handle Tesla's aluminum construction?
Not all auto body shops are equally equipped or trained to handle Tesla's extensive use of aluminum. Specialized knowledge and specific tools (like aluminum-specific welders and repair benches) are required to prevent contamination and ensure structural integrity. Shops that explicitly mention aluminum repair expertise are preferred.
What is the importance of recalibrating Tesla's sensors after a body repair?
Recalibrating sensors (like those for Autopilot, lane keeping, and parking assist) is critical after a body repair because their position and alignment can be affected. Improper calibration can lead to malfunctioning safety features, compromising the vehicle's performance and the driver's safety.
